The China General Chamber of Commerce-USA (CGCC) is hosting a special webinar with Littler on the new employment, discrimination and immigration enforcement environment for multinational companies doing business in the United States. The Trump administration has issued Executive Orders and taken many other significant steps to challenge di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) policies and environmental, social, and governance (ESG) policies, and significantly limited key immigration programs.

Littler Shareholders Philip Berkowitz, Brandon Mita, and Shin-I Lowe will explain these changes, how they are affecting multinational companies, and offer best practices for compliance. Finally, Littler Shareholder Katherine Siegel will discuss the inroads unions are making in white-collar industries and how best to prepare.
